Markdown pipeline runbook — Ferngate renderer. If preview output is blank, check the Slateroot sanitizer stage first; it silently drops documents over 2MB. Restart the worker pool, then replay the failed queue from the Mirrowell dashboard. Do not clear the cache unless rendering errors persist after replay. Escalate to the Ferngate on-call if replay loops twice. Verification requires the trace token from the last successful replay, shown below.

trace token, yahif-kagep: htk31_bd0cc6b1d7ab4f7094c586a5de900e0

To: Dispatch Desk. Subject: Calibration weights — outbound batch. The batch of twelve certified calibration weights for the Stornhale metrology lab is packed and sealed in the grey transit case. Each weight sits in its numbered cradle; the certificates are in the document sleeve inside the lid. Please note the case must remain upright and must not be opened before it reaches the lab, or the certification is void. Collection is booked for tomorrow morning. The hand-over instruction for the courier is as follows:

drop instructions, yahip-fahag: the novix praeth courier leaves the jorox ledger at gate 1058 under passcode 030252

# Sweepwell Environments

Plugin authors: the Sweepwell data-retention sweeper runs independently per environment, and retention windows differ deliberately between staging and production. Plugins must never hardcode sweep intervals; always read them at startup, since operators adjust them during incident response. The authoritative per-environment values currently in effect are reproduced below.

deployment values, yahag-tawef:
ZORWYN_HOST=zorwyn.tolvaqlabs.internal
ZORWYN_PORT=9300

Subject: Zero-downtime migrations — plugin author notes

Heads up: Orchardbase 4.2 ships the expand-contract migration flow. Your plugins must tolerate both old and new schemas during the overlap window — no hard column assumptions. Write paths should use the compatibility views until the contract phase completes. Migrations run nightly; breakage gets your plugin auto-disabled. Test against the staging snapshot tagged with the build token below.

pipeline stamp: htk3_69f